Girls still rule in Sussex after Abi Fryer was the unexpected but worthy winner of the Under 11 championships. Following in the footsteps of last year’s Sussex star, Stephanie Barraclough, Abi swept all before her (well almost) including the pre-tournament favourite Andrew Tucker to take the title by half a point. Sussex U8 Championship
This would appear to be the tournament for unknown players to make their mark. For the second year running a player who has never played in any other Sussex event took the title.
